Re: Advice on rollers
They look well priced to me. The advantage of a trainer can be adding resistance to your ride. It turns out only to be a problem for a track bike for the most part, as you can go up gears on a road bike to some extent.

TV schedule for track worlds
Minsk hosts the 2013 UCI Track Cycling World Championships from Wednesday 20 to Sunday 24 February. The UCI Track Cycling World Championships stands at the pinnacle of world track cycling and will attract up to 350 of the world’s best cyclists from more than 40 countries.
